Road cycling routes around Frascaro, located in Italy's Piedmont region, feature a varied landscape of rolling hills and agricultural scenery. The area is characterized by a tranquil, hilly environment, providing diverse gradients for cyclists. The presence of the Tanaro River and quiet roads further enhances the cycling experience, offering scenic views and lighter traffic.

Borgoratto Alessandrino, in the province of Alessandria, is known as the "Town of Artists" for having been the birthplace or home to notable painters and sculptors. Inaugurated in May 2023, the project enhances the village as an open-air gallery, including an art trail, a parish church with 20th-century works, a "Garden of Welcome," and a large panoramic bench.

Frascaro is characterized by a tranquil, hilly landscape with rolling hills and diverse gradients, offering engaging rides. You'll also find extensive agricultural scenery, with cycle paths often flanked by fields, and quiet roads with lighter traffic, enhancing the overall cycling experience.
There are over 60 road cycling routes around Frascaro, catering to various skill levels. You'll find a good mix of easy, moderate, and difficult options to explore the region's diverse landscapes.
Yes, Frascaro offers 8 easy road cycling routes. An example is the Bridge over the Bormida loop from Carentino, which is a 25.8-mile (41.6 km) trail leading through riverine landscapes.
Many routes offer views of the Tanaro River and agricultural fields. You can also encounter unique landmarks like the Vineyard of the Colorful Pencils in Mombaruzzo, a distinctive land art installation. Historical sites such as the Abbey of Santa Giustina, dating back to 722 AD, are also within reach.
Yes, many routes in Frascaro are designed as loops. For instance, the Ricaldone and Gavi vineyards - Ring tour is a 51-mile (82.1 km) circular route offering extensive vineyard views. Another option is the Langhe Vineyards – Tomb of Luigi Tenco loop from Borgoratto, which winds through more vineyard landscapes.
While specific seasonal recommendations aren't provided, the region's tranquil and natural setting, combined with its agricultural scenery, suggests that spring and autumn would offer pleasant temperatures and beautiful landscapes for cycling. Summer can also be enjoyable, especially in the mornings or late afternoons.
Yes, Frascaro offers 19 difficult routes and 40 moderate routes for those seeking a challenge. The Castle Square, Moasca – Big Bench Fontanile loop from Borgoratto is a moderate 51.6-mile (82.9 km) route with significant elevation gain, providing a good workout.
Yes, the Solero–Alessandria Cycle Path is a notable intermediate cycle way in the vicinity. It's flanked by fields and runs alongside a railway, offering a distinct and enjoyable route.
The road cycling routes in Frascaro are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.7 stars from over 30 reviews. Cyclists often praise the varied terrain, scenic views, and the quiet nature of the roads.
Many routes in the region allow you to combine natural beauty with cultural exploration. For example, the Cittadella Bridge – Roman Aqueduct of Acqui Terme loop from Sezzadio is a moderate 47.6-mile (76.6 km) route that passes by historical points of interest, allowing you to experience both the landscape and the rich history of the area.
